Academic Bars in Chongqing: A New Youth Culture

By FENG, XIAOLOU|Dec 29,2024

Chongqing - A new cultural trend has emerged in Chongqing - academic bars in recent months. These unconventional venues blend intellectual discussions with casual social gatherings, creating a dynamic space for the city's youth to engage with a variety of academic subjects outside the classroom. 

One of the representatives in this trend is Hanhan, the owner of Zhengdian Homebar and the leader of an AI study group, who has brought the academic bar concept to life in Chongqing.

This new wave of academic bars began earlier this year, with Hanhan's bar hosting a series of lectures on topics ranging from psychology to folklore, attracting a diverse crowd. 

"The guests who come to my bar fall into two extremes - those seeking entertainment and those in search of serious academic exchange," Hanhan explains. "But there are also many who fall somewhere in between." 

Hanhan's model fosters a collaborative environment unlike traditional academic settings, where one person speaks and others listen passively. After the host delivers the main lecture, participants are encouraged to share their views, discuss the topic, and engage with one another, making it a lively exchange of ideas.

When asked how she balances the seriousness of academic content witha bar'se relaxed, entertaining naturr, Hanhan said, "My academic bar events aren’t about teachers delivering long lectures like they do in classrooms. After theevent's first halft, where the host shares their insights, the most important part is the subsequent open discussion. People are encouraged to clash their ideas and experiences with the topic at hand and to interact with others on equal terms. This is how we balance seriousness and leisure."

Attendees range from young people to children and middle-aged individuals, reflecting the inclusive nature of the events. Many are willing to commute up to two hours to attend these academic sessions, followed by more informal conversations and drinks.

One of the notable figures in Chongqing’s academic bar scene is Chengtuo, a young scholar who returned to Chongqing after studying in South Korea. 

Chengtuo has organized several academic events at Zhengdian Homebar. His personal connection with the bar was highlighted during one event when he proposed to his girlfriend during a debate on "Which is Happier: Loving or Being Loved?" The entire bar celebrated the intimate moment. In retrospection, "I hope that it becomes a sort of inspiration to my friends met in the bar to go for a better life," said Chengtuo.

This December, Hanhan expanded her vision by relocating to a larger, two-story venue, hoping to further grow the academic bar culture in Chongqing. In addition to continuing the academic events, she plans to turn the space into a youth entrepreneurship club, supporting young entrepreneurs in the city by providing a place for networking, advice, and funding opportunities.
